While expecting all these games on launch day is optimistic, even a partial release would be exciting. Here are some strong contenders:
High-Probability Titles:
-
Mario Kart 9: Given Mario Kart 8's phenomenal success, a sequel is almost guaranteed. A "new twist" is rumored, promising fresh gameplay for a new generation. A launch-day release would be a significant system seller.
-
New 3D Super Mario: The Switch surprisingly lacked multiple 3D Mario titles. A new entry, brimming with innovative mechanics and level design, is highly anticipated. Pairing it with Mario Kart 9 would be a powerful launch statement.
-
Metroid Prime 4: Beyond: After years of anticipation and a developer shift to Retro Studios, Metroid Prime 4: Beyond is generating considerable hype. Its smooth gameplay suggests potential Switch 2 optimization, making a launch-day release plausible.
-
The Legend of Zelda: Breath of the Wild and Tears of the Kingdom Enhanced: Backward compatibility is expected, but enhanced versions leveraging the Switch 2's power (e.g., 4K resolution, improved frame rate) would be a welcome addition.
Strong Contenders:
-
Ring Fit Adventure 2: The original Ring Fit Adventure defied expectations. A sequel utilizing the Switch 2's capabilities could be a unique launch title.
-
Resident Evil 4 Remake: While graphically demanding, the Switch 2 might handle Capcom's masterpiece. A launch-day release would showcase the console's power and resonate with horror fans.
-
Doom: The Dark Ages: With previous Doom titles on Switch and Microsoft's cross-platform approach, this new entry could be a surprise addition. The upcoming Xbox Developer Direct may reveal more.
Indie Darlings:
-
The Haunted Chocolatier: Following the success of Stardew Valley, ConcernedApe's new game is highly anticipated. A launch-year release is more realistic, but a launch-day appearance would be a delightful surprise.
-
Earthblade: The sequel to Celeste is a promising title. While updates have been infrequent, a 2025 release aligns with the Switch 2's launch window.
